Join ECS Group – Powering Safety, Performance & Compliance Across the UK

ECS Group is a trusted leader in electrical compliance and testing services, delivering high-quality, safety-focused solutions across a range of sectors.

As we expand our Electrical Testing Division, we’re seeking a driven and experienced Business Development Executive to help us grow our presence nationwide — with a particular focus on the social housing sector.

  • Salary
  • To £55k (Depending on experience) + Car allowance or Company Car + Commission + Benefits

Key Responsibilities

  • Identify and secure new business opportunities across the UK, with a strong focus on social housing providers, local authorities, and housing associations.
  • Lead the end-to-end tendering process, from opportunity identification through to bid submission and contract award.
  • Build and manage a robust pipeline of leads, proposals, and strategic partnerships.
  • Present tailored compliance solutions to both new and existing clients, aligning with their regulatory and operational needs.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ure smooth onboarding and delivery of services.
  • What We’re Looking For
  • Proven experience in business development or B2B sales, ideally within the electrical compliance, testing, or facilities management sectors.
  • Demonstrable experience working with social housing clients, including navigating procurement frameworks and public sector tendering processes.
  • Strong commercial acumen and the ability to build long-term client relationships.
  • Excellent communication, negotiation, and presentation skills.
  • Self-starter with the ability to manage a national territory and work independently.
